Confusing error message when saving file

Asked by Daniel Robitaille on 2006-05-24

bug initially reported using reportbug

---------- Forwarded message ----------
From: Sam Morris <email address hidden>
To: Ubuntu Bug Tracking System <email address hidden>
Date: Tue, 23 May 2006 13:04:28 +0100
Subject: xsane: Confusing error message when saving files
Package: xsane
Version: 0.97-3ubuntu2
Severity: normal

My Dad was scanning some documents and was very confused by the error
message that xsane gives when he tried to save a file name containing the
forward slash character, '/'. The error message is:

 Could not create secure file (may be a link does exist): %(filename)s

A replacement error message needs to make two things clear to the
user:

 1. That '/' is a directory separator and can not appear in a file name
 2. That the relative path that he entered refers to a directory that
    does not exist

-- System Information:
Debian Release: testing/unstable
 APT prefers breezy-updates
 APT policy: (600, 'breezy-updates'), (600, 'breezy-security'), (600, 'breezy')
Architecture: i386 (i686)
Shell: /bin/sh linked to /bin/bash
Kernel: Linux 2.6.12-10-k7
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)

Versions of packages xsane depends on:
ii libatk1.0-0 1.10.3-0ubuntu2 The ATK accessibility toolkit
ii libc6 2.3.5-1ubuntu12.5.10.1 GNU C Library: Shared libraries an
ii libcairo2 1.0.2-0ubuntu1.1 The Cairo 2D vector graphics libra
ii libfontconfig1 2.3.2-1ubuntu4 generic font configuration library
ii libgimp2.0 2.2.8-2ubuntu6 Libraries necessary to Run the GIM
ii libglib2.0-0 2.8.3-0ubuntu1 The GLib library of C routines
ii libgtk2.0-0 2.8.6-0ubuntu2.1 The GTK+ graphical user interface
ii libieee1284-3 0.2.10-1 cross-platform library for paralle
ii libjpeg62 6b-10 The Independent JPEG Group's JPEG
ii libpango1.0-0 1.10.1-0ubuntu1 Layout and rendering of internatio
ii libpng12-0 1.2.8rel-1ubuntu3 PNG library - runtime
ii libsane 1.0.17-1ubuntu3 API library for scanners
ii libtiff4 3.7.3-1ubuntu1.1 Tag Image File Format (TIFF) libra
ii libusb-0.1-4 2:0.1.10a-17ubuntu1 userspace USB programming library
ii libx11-6 1:6.2.1+cvs.20050722-8 X11 client-side library
ii libxcursor1 1.1.4-0ubuntu5 X cursor management library
ii libxext6 1:6.4.3-3 X11 miscellaneous extension librar
ii libxfixes3 1:3.0.0-3 X11 miscellaneous 'fixes' extensio
ii libxi6 1:1.3.0-2 X11 Input extension library
ii libxinerama1 1:1.1.0+cvs.20050821-1 X11 Xinerama extension library
ii libxrandr2 1:1.0.2-2 X11 RandR extension library
ii libxrender1 1:0.9.0-1 X Rendering Extension client libra
ii xsane-common 0.97-3ubuntu2 GTK+-based X11 frontend for SANE (
ii zlib1g 1:1.2.3-3ubuntu4 compression library - runtime

Versions of packages xsane recommends:
ii epiphany-browser [ 1.8.2-0ubuntu1 Intuitive GNOME web browser
ii firefox [www-brows 1.0.8-0ubuntu5.10 lightweight web browser based on M
ii lynx [www-browser] 2.8.5-2ubuntu0.5.10.1 Text-mode WWW Browser
ii w3m [www-browser] 0.5.1-3ubuntu1 WWW browsable pager with excellent

-- no debconf information

Question information

Language:
English Edit question
Status:
Answered
For:
Ubuntu xsane Edit question
Assignee:
No assignee Edit question
Last query:
2006-05-24
Last reply:
2009-02-11
Brian Murray (brian-murray) said : #1

We are closing this bug report as it concerns Breezy which is no longer supported. However, please reopen it if it is still an issue with a supported version of Ubuntu and feel free to submit bug reports in the future.

Sam Morris (yrro) said : #2

This is still present in gutsy.

Please don't close bugs like this without taking the time to see if they are still reproducable! This is *very* annoying and makes me much less inclined to bother reporting bugs in the future. See <http://www.jwz.org/doc/cadt.html> for more information.

Brian Murray (brian-murray) said : #3

I've recreated this bug report using xsane version 0.99+0.991-3ubuntu5 on Gutsy Gibbon.

Steps to reproduce:
1) Scan an image
2) Choose save and use a file name with a "/" in the name

Hew (hew) said : #4

This issue still exists in Hardy Heron with xsane 0.995-1ubuntu1

Jaap (jpbn) said : #5

error while saving could not create secure file.
xsane tells me this error when I am scanning a document.
I do not try to name this document with backslashes or other signs, just a name .

someone tries to close this bug, but it is a new bug. happens only after latest upgrade.
thanks
JPBN

Jaap (jpbn) said : #6

I do try to find a solution. This bug with the slash in the file name is helping me in overcoming a problem.

Xsane do make the scanner (HP scanjet 8300) make a scan.
a file appears on my screen xsane-conversion-avision:libusb:002:004.ppm-1000-bUVP3N.
(if i do not use this bug with the slash in the file name this file disappears wtihin some seconds.)
by using this bug I can edit the file xsane-conversion-avision:libusb:002:004.ppm-1000-bUVP3N and safe it as a jpg-file with the scanned file. But this way I cannot save it as PDF-file.

Can you help with this problem?

Provide an answer of your own, or ask Daniel Robitaille for more information if necessary.

To post a message you must log in.